Image 1 of 1
Senegal, Touba.  "Lamp Fall" on a transport vehicle identifies the owner or driver as a follower of Sheikh Ibrahima Fall, one of the most influential disciples of the founder of the Mouride Islamic brotherhood, Ahmadu Bamba.  "Lamp Fall" is also the name of the tallest minaret of the Grand Mosque of Touba, where Ahmadu Bamba is buried.